Pregunta

¿Alguien tiene buenos enlaces para desarrollar campos personalizados y tipos de contenido que no impliquen el uso de VSeWSS? La mayoría de las cosas que he visto en la web requieren la instalación de VSeWSS, preferiría compilarlas desde cero con solo VS2005.

Gracias

¿Fue útil?

Solución

Entiendo la idea de hacerlo a mano primero sin una herramienta que ayude.

Pero, terminarás creando una gran cantidad de XML a mano. Realmente dolerá y llevará mucho tiempo.

Recomendaría STSDev personalmente. Úselo para crear la solución y las características para los tipos y campos de contenido personalizados, incluidos los controles personalizados.

Una vez que se haya creado el paquete, puedes realizar una ingeniería inversa para descubrir las tuercas y los tornillos de cómo se mantiene todo el conjunto.

Si lo haces en una máquina virtual, aún puedes mantener una instalación virgen de 2005 para revertirla cuando quieras.

Creo que esto aumentará el tiempo para entender lo que está pasando con los tipos y campos de contenido.

Otros consejos

Utilicé estos blogs para ayudarme con los campos personalizados Here and Aquí

Tampoco estoy seguro acerca de los tipos de contenido personalizados. Sin embargo, si desea evitar VSeWSS, ¿está usando otra opción de complemento de Visual Studio? WSPBuilder incluye plantillas para los tipos de campos personalizados.

El MOSS Feature Generator en CodePlex es una herramienta muy robusta que crea características a partir de los datos existentes del sitio, lo que significa que puede crear todo lo que desee con la GUI y luego exportarlo como funciones. Esto es muy útil para aprender cómo crear cosas, así como para convertir cosas existentes en características. Funciona con tipos de contenido, columnas del sitio, listas, etc.

Echa un vistazo a las herramientas rápidas y SPDeploy:

http://rapid-tools.googlecode.com

SPDeploy le permite desarrollar localmente una solución utilizando Visual Studio e implementar un wsp generado automáticamente de forma remota.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top